HUMIDITY--INCREASING

A high humidity is essential for most houseplants during winter months. To increase humidity level:

1. Place plants in typically humid rooms such as the bathroom, kitchen or laundry rooms.

2. Group plants together. As water transpires through the leaves, a miniature humidity chamber is temporarily created.

3. Use a cool water vaporizer.

4. Use a humidifier. Turn the thermostat down to 65ø F.

5. Set plants on a tray filled with pea gravel. Fill the tray with water, just below the bottom of the pot. As the water evaporates, the plants will be surrounded by a temporary humidity change.
